COMMISSION IMPLEMENTING REGULATION (EU) No 669/2014

of 18 June 2014

concerning the authorisation of calcium D-pantothenate and D-panthenol as feed additives for all animal species

(Text with EEA relevance)



Article 1

The substances specified in the Annex, belonging to the additive category ‘nutritional additives’ and to the functional group ‘vitamins, pro-vitamins and chemically well-defined substances having similar effect’, are authorised as additives in animal nutrition subject to the conditions laid down in that Annex.

Article 2

The substances specified in the Annex and feed containing those substances, which are produced and labelled before 9 January 2015 in accordance with the rules applicable before 9 July 2014 may continue to be placed on the market and used until the existing stocks are exhausted.

Article 3

This Regulation shall enter into force on the twentieth day following that of its publication in the Official Journal of the European Union.

This Regulation shall be binding in its entirety and directly applicable in all Member States.

Category: Nutritional additives. Functional group: vitamins, pro-vitamins and chemically well-defined substances having similar effect

3a841

Calcium D-pantothenate

Additive composition

Calcium D-pantothenate.

Characterisation of the active substance

Calcium D-pantothenate

Ca[C9H16NO5]2

CAS No: 137-08-6

Calcium D-pantothenate, solid form, produced by chemical synthesis.

Purity criteria:

1.  Min. 98 % (on dry basis)

2.  Max. 0,5 % 3-aminopropionic acid.

Method of Analysis (1)

— For the determination of Calcium D-pantothenate in the feed additive: potentiometric titration with perchloric acid and identification by specific optical rotation (European Pharmacopoeia monograph 0470).

— For the determination of Calcium D-pantothenate in premixtures and feedingstuffs: Reverse Phase High-Performance Liquid Chromatography coupled to a single-quadrupole mass selective detector (RP-HPLC-MS).

All animal species.

1.  May be used also via water for drinking.

2.  In the directions for use of the additive and premixture, indicate the storage and stability conditions.

3.  For safety: breathing protection, safety glasses and gloves should be worn during handling.

►C1  9 July 2024 ◄

3a842

D-Panthenol

Additive composition

D-Panthenol

Characterisation of the active substance.

D-Panthenol

C9H19NO4

CAS No: 81-13-0

D-Panthenol, liquid form, produced by chemical synthesis

Purity criteria:

1.  Min. 98 % on anhydrous basis (water < 1 %)

2.  Max. 0,5 % 3-aminopropanol.

Method of Analysis (1)

— For the determination of D-panthenol in the feed additive: titration with perchloric acid and potassium hydrogen phthalate and identification by specific optical rotation and infrared spectroscopy (European Pharmacopoeia monograph 0761).

— For the determination of D-panthenol in water: Reverse Phase High-Performance Liquid Chromatography, coupled to UV detector (RP-HPLC).

All animal species

 

1.  To be used only via water for drinking.

2.  In the directions for use of the additive indicate the storage conditions.

3.  For safety: breathing protection, safety glasses and gloves should be worn during handling.

►C1  9 July 2024 ◄
